First Article Inspection (FAI) is a formal verification process that a new or modified manufacturing process will produce parts that meet all engineering design requirements. In UAE defence and aerospace manufacturing — particularly for EDGE Group Tier-2 suppliers, Strata MRO work, and NIMR vehicle components — FAI is not optional. It is contractually required under AS9100D and, for certain programmes, NADCAP. Getting your FAI process right from the start saves weeks of rework and protects your supplier approval status.
What Is First Article Inspection (FAI)?
FAI is defined in AS9102 (Aerospace First Article Inspection Requirement). It documents that a part produced by a specific manufacturing process — on a specific machine, by a specific operator, using specific tooling and materials — conforms to all dimensions, tolerances, materials, and surface finish requirements of the engineering drawing.
The key distinction from routine inspection: FAI is process validation, not just part inspection. It validates that your process can reliably produce conforming parts — not just that one part happened to pass.
The AS9102 FAI Package: What You Must Submit
A complete FAI package under AS9102 consists of three primary sections:
Section 1 — Design Documentation
- Current revision drawing with all applicable notes and callouts
- List of all applicable specifications and standards referenced on the drawing
- Engineering change order (ECO) traceability if the part is a revision
- Bubble-numbered drawing with each dimension uniquely identified
Section 2 — Material and Process Documentation
- Material certification (CoC) traceable to heat/lot number
- Chemical and mechanical properties test report
- Process specification conformance records (heat treatment, surface treatment, plating, NDT)
- NADCAP special process approvals (if applicable to your process)
Section 3 — Dimensional Inspection Data
- Measurement results for every balloon-numbered dimension on the drawing
- Traceability of all measurement equipment (calibration certificates)
- Gauge R&R (measurement system analysis) for critical characteristics
- Non-conformance disposition (if any dimension is outside tolerance)
Measurement Equipment Requirements for FAI
Every measurement in an FAI package must be taken with calibrated, traceable equipment. UAE defence suppliers typically need the following instruments — all calibrated to UKAS, DAkkS, or equivalent national standards:
| Measurement type | Typical instrument | Accuracy requirement |
|---|---|---|
| Linear OD/ID | Outside micrometer, bore gauge + dial indicator | 0.001 mm resolution minimum |
| Length and depth | Digital vernier calliper, height gauge with granite surface plate | 0.01 mm resolution; 0.001 mm for critical dims |
| Surface roughness (Ra) | Surface roughness tester (profilometer) | Ra to 0.01 µm resolution |
| Thread gauging | Go / No-Go thread plug and ring gauges | Per applicable thread standard (ISO 965, ASME B1.1) |
| Concentricity / runout | Dial test indicator on V-blocks or CMM | 0.001 mm resolution; CMM preferred for GD&T callouts |
| Flatness / squareness | Dial gauge on surface plate, CMM | Per drawing tolerance; surface plate Grade A for <0.01mm requirements |
| Complex geometry (GD&T) | CMM (coordinate measuring machine) | Required for position, true position, profile callouts |

Common FAI Failures — and How to Avoid Them
- Missing bubble numbers on drawing: Every dimension submitted in the inspection data package must correspond to a bubble number on the drawing. Prepare the bubble drawing before you start measuring.
- Out-of-calibration equipment used: Check calibration due dates before starting your FAI measurement run. An FAI signed off with an expired calliper will be rejected.
- Material certificate not lot-traceable: CoC must trace to the specific heat/lot used for the first article — not just the material specification. Buy from distributors who can provide heat-traced CoCs.
- Gauge R&R skipped for critical characteristics: AS9100D customer requirements often mandate Gauge R&R (ANOVA or range method) for safety-critical or key characteristics. If your drawing has KC or SC callouts, plan for GR&R from the start.
- FAI documentation not revision-controlled: Your FAI package is a controlled quality record. Use your document control system — free-form Word documents without revision numbers will fail EDGE Group QA audits.
